Understanding Durability and Performance

Durability refers to how well a technology maintains its functionality over time, resisting wear and tear, obsolescence, and environmental factors. Performance, on the other hand, pertains to how effectively a technology performs its intended functions, including speed, efficiency, and reliability. Both aspects are crucial for assessing long-term value.

Solid-State Drives (SSDs) vs. Hard Disk Drives (HDDs)

SSD technology offers faster data access speeds and greater resistance to physical shocks compared to traditional HDDs. While HDDs may have a longer history, SSDs are increasingly seen as more durable and better suited for long-term performance, especially in portable devices.

Wireless vs. Wired Connectivity

Wired connections generally provide more stable and consistent performance over time, with less susceptibility to interference. Wireless technologies, such as Wi-Fi and Bluetooth, offer convenience but may experience fluctuations in performance due to environmental factors, impacting long-term reliability.

Factors Influencing Long-Term Value

  • Build Quality: High-quality components tend to last longer and perform more reliably.
  • Technological Advancements: Emerging innovations can render older technologies obsolete faster.
  • Environmental Conditions: Exposure to elements like moisture, heat, or dust can degrade performance over time.
  • Maintenance and Support: Regular updates and repairs extend the lifespan of technology.

Case Study: Smartphones

Modern smartphones exemplify the importance of durability and performance in long-term value. Brands that incorporate robust materials, such as Gorilla Glass and water resistance, tend to offer better longevity. Additionally, devices with efficient processors and software support maintain high performance over several years, providing better overall value.
